Buckhead.  In 1837, Henry Irby’s general store & tavern stood at the corner of what we now call W. Paces Ferry Road and Roswell Road. The legend is that on post outside the store & tavern was a large buck’s head serving as a marker for the store.  Buckhead was placed on the National Registrar of Historic Places in 1929.   You will find the Governor’s Mansion on W. Paces Ferry Road in Buckhead just down the street from the Atlanta History Center.   There is a variety homes in Buckhead from mansions to homes to condos to lofts to townhomes.  Buckhead has a wide range of  home styles ranging from traditional, modern, post war and mid-century modern.  Click here for more information.

Neighborhoods in buckhead:  Brookwood Hills, Collier Hills, Garden Hills, Peachtree Park, Peachtree Hills, Tuxedo Park
